John Stevens
Fiery-haired vocalist and former American Idol contestant John Stevens was born in 1987 and raised in East Amherst, NY. His love for jazz, big band, and swing began with the discovery of his grandparents' record collection. Stevens found kindred spirits in the works of Dean Martin, Duke Ellington, and most importantly Frank Sinatra. It was his spot-on emulation of Sinatra's singing style and old-fashioned mannerisms that kept him in contention well into season three. After participating in the obligatory postseason Idol tour, he signed with Maverick Records. Red, a collection of covers and standards, was released in June of 2006. ~ James Christopher Monger, All Music Guide
